Definitions:

Role Playing

A training or problem-solving technique where individuals simulate actions and decisions in specific roles or scenarios to develop skills or analyze situations.

Developmental Needs

The requirements necessary for an individual's growth and improvement, often identified in educational and professional settings to enhance skills and knowledge.

Judgemental Role

A position within a decision-making process where evaluation, assessment, and determination based on evidence or insight are required.

Subordinate

An employee or team member who reports to a supervisor or someone in a higher position within the organization's hierarchy.
